356 changes: 356 additions & 0 deletions app/client/src/utils/multiOrgDomains.test.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,356 @@
import {
trackCurrentDomain,
getRecentDomains,
clearRecentDomains,
isValidAppsmithDomain,
} from "./multiOrgDomains";

const MOCK_DATE = 1609459200000;

Date.now = jest.fn(() => MOCK_DATE);

const mockLocation = {
hostname: "test.appsmith.com",
};

Object.defineProperty(window, "location", {
value: mockLocation,
writable: true,
});

let cookieStore = "";

Object.defineProperty(document, "cookie", {
get: jest.fn(() => cookieStore),
set: jest.fn((cookieString: string) => {
if (cookieString.includes("expires=Thu, 01 Jan 1970")) {
cookieStore = "";
} else {
const [nameValue] = cookieString.split(";");

cookieStore = nameValue;
}
}),
configurable: true,
});

const mockCookieGetter = Object.getOwnPropertyDescriptor(document, "cookie")
?.get as jest.MockedFunction<() => string>;
const mockCookieSetter = Object.getOwnPropertyDescriptor(document, "cookie")
?.set as jest.MockedFunction<(value: string) => void>;

describe("multiOrgDomains", () => {
beforeEach(() => {
cookieStore = "";
mockLocation.hostname = "test.appsmith.com";

(Date.now as jest.Mock).mockClear();
mockCookieGetter.mockClear();
mockCookieSetter?.mockClear?.();
});

afterEach(() => {
jest.clearAllTimers();
});

describe("isValidAppsmithDomain", () => {
it("should return true for valid appsmith domains", () => {
expect(isValidAppsmithDomain("example.appsmith.com")).toBe(true);
expect(isValidAppsmithDomain("company.appsmith.com")).toBe(true);
expect(isValidAppsmithDomain("test-org.appsmith.com")).toBe(true);
});

it("should return false for invalid appsmith domains", () => {
expect(isValidAppsmithDomain("example.com")).toBe(false);
expect(isValidAppsmithDomain("example.appsmith.co")).toBe(false);
expect(isValidAppsmithDomain("appsmith.com")).toBe(false);
});

it("should return false for excluded appsmith subdomains", () => {
expect(isValidAppsmithDomain("login.appsmith.com")).toBe(false);
expect(isValidAppsmithDomain("release.appsmith.com")).toBe(false);
expect(isValidAppsmithDomain("app.appsmith.com")).toBe(false);
expect(isValidAppsmithDomain("dev.appsmith.com")).toBe(false);
});

it("should handle edge cases", () => {
expect(isValidAppsmithDomain("")).toBe(false);
expect(isValidAppsmithDomain("login.test.appsmith.com")).toBe(false);
expect(isValidAppsmithDomain("test.login.appsmith.com")).toBe(true);
});
});

describe("trackCurrentDomain", () => {
it("should track current domain when it's a valid multi-org domain", () => {
mockLocation.hostname = "example.appsmith.com";

trackCurrentDomain();

expect(mockCookieSetter).toHaveBeenCalledWith(
expect.stringContaining("appsmith_recent_domains="),
);
});

it("should not track domain when it's not a valid multi-org domain", () => {
mockLocation.hostname = "example.com";

trackCurrentDomain();

expect(mockCookieSetter).not.toHaveBeenCalled();
});

it("should not track excluded appsmith domains", () => {
mockLocation.hostname = "login.appsmith.com";

trackCurrentDomain();

expect(mockCookieSetter).not.toHaveBeenCalled();
});

it("should add current domain to the beginning of the list", () => {
mockLocation.hostname = "example.appsmith.com";

const existingDomains = [
{ domain: "other.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"another.appsmith.com", timestamp: MOCK_DATE - 200000 },
];

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(existingDomains))}`;

trackCurrentDomain();

const setCookieCall = mockCookieSetter.mock.calls[0][0];
const cookieValue = setCookieCall.split("=")[1].split(";")[0];
const decodedDomains = JSON.parse(decodeURIComponent(cookieValue));

expect(decodedDomains[0].domain).toBe("example.appsmith.com");
expect(decodedDomains[0].timestamp).toBe(MOCK_DATE);
});

it("should remove duplicate entries of current domain", () => {
mockLocation.hostname = "example.appsmith.com";

const existingDomains = [
{ domain: "other.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"example.appsmith.com", timestamp: MOCK_DATE - 150000 },
{ domain: "another.appsmith.com", timestamp: MOCK_DATE - 200000 },
];

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(existingDomains))}`;

trackCurrentDomain();

const setCookieCall = mockCookieSetter.mock.calls[0][0];
const cookieValue = setCookieCall.split("=")[1].split(";")[0];
const decodedDomains = JSON.parse(decodeURIComponent(cookieValue));

const exampleDomains = decodedDomains.filter(
(d: { domain: string }) => d.domain === "example.appsmith.com",
);

expect(exampleDomains).toHaveLength(1);
expect(exampleDomains[0].timestamp).toBe(MOCK_DATE);
});

it("should limit stored domains to MAX_DOMAINS (10)", () => {
mockLocation.hostname = "example.appsmith.com";

const existingDomains = Array.from({ length: 10 }, (_, i) => ({
domain: `domain${i}.appsmith.com`,
timestamp: MOCK_DATE - (i + 1) * 1000,
}));

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(existingDomains))}`;

trackCurrentDomain();

const setCookieCall = mockCookieSetter.mock.calls[0][0];
const cookieValue = setCookieCall.split("=")[1].split(";")[0];
const decodedDomains = JSON.parse(decodeURIComponent(cookieValue));

expect(decodedDomains).toHaveLength(10);
expect(decodedDomains[0].domain).toBe("example.appsmith.com");
expect(
decodedDomains.some(
(d: { domain: string }) => d.domain === "domain9.appsmith.com",
),
).toBe(false);
});

it("should filter out domains older than 30 days", () => {
mockLocation.hostname = "example.appsmith.com";

const thirtyOneDaysAgo = MOCK_DATE - 31 * 24 * 60 * 60 * 1000;
const existingDomains = [
{ domain: "recent.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"old.appsmith.com", timestamp: thirtyOneDaysAgo },
];

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(existingDomains))}`;

trackCurrentDomain();

const setCookieCall = mockCookieSetter.mock.calls[0][0];
const cookieValue = setCookieCall.split("=")[1].split(";")[0];
const decodedDomains = JSON.parse(decodeURIComponent(cookieValue));

expect(decodedDomains).toHaveLength(2); // current + recent
expect(
decodedDomains.some(
(d: { domain: string }) => d.domain === "old.appsmith.com",
),
).toBe(false);
expect(
decodedDomains.some(
(d: { domain: string }) => d.domain === "recent.appsmith.com",
),
).toBe(true);
});

it("should handle invalid cookie data gracefully", () => {
mockLocation.hostname = "example.appsmith.com";
cookieStore = "appsmith_recent_domains=invalid-json";

expect(() => trackCurrentDomain()).not.toThrow();

const setCookieCall = mockCookieSetter.mock.calls[0][0];

expect(setCookieCall).toContain("appsmith_recent_domains=");
});
});

describe("getRecentDomains", () => {
it("should return empty array when no domains are stored", () => {
const result = getRecentDomains();

expect(result).toEqual([]);
});

it("should return recent domains excluding current domain", () => {
mockLocation.hostname = "current.appsmith.com";

const storedDomains = [
{ domain: "current.appsmith.com", timestamp: MOCK_DATE },
{ domain: "other.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"another.appsmith.com", timestamp: MOCK_DATE - 200000 },
];

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(storedDomains))}`;

const result = getRecentDomains();

expect(result).toEqual(["other.appsmith.com", "another.appsmith.com"]);
});

it("should filter out domains older than 30 days", () => {
const thirtyOneDaysAgo = MOCK_DATE - 31 * 24 * 60 * 60 * 1000;
const storedDomains = [
{ domain: "recent.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"old.appsmith.com", timestamp: thirtyOneDaysAgo },
];

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(storedDomains))}`;

const result = getRecentDomains();

expect(result).toEqual(["recent.appsmith.com"]);
});

it("should filter out invalid appsmith domains", () => {
const storedDomains = [
{ domain: "valid.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"login.appsmith.com", timestamp: MOCK_DATE - 100000 },
{ domain: "invalid.com", timestamp: MOCK_DATE - 100000 },
];

cookieStore = `appsmith_recent_domains=${encodeURIComponent(JSON.stringify(storedDomains))}`;

const result = getRecentDomains();

expect(result).toEqual(["valid.appsmith.com"]);
});

it("should handle invalid cookie data gracefully", () => {
cookieStore = "appsmith_recent_domains=invalid-json";

const result = getRecentDomains();

expect(result).toEqual([]);
});

it("should handle missing cookie gracefully", () => {
const result = getRecentDomains();

expect(result).toEqual([]);
});
});

describe("clearRecentDomains", () => {
it("should clear the recent domains cookie", () => {
clearRecentDomains();

expect(mockCookieSetter).toHaveBeenCalledWith(
"appsmith_recent_domains=; expires=Thu, 01 Jan 1970 00:00:00 UTC; domain=.appsmith.com; path=/;",
);
});

it("should remove domains from storage", () => {
cookieStore = "appsmith_recent_domains=some-value";

clearRecentDomains();

expect(cookieStore).toBe("");
});
});

describe("edge cases and error handling", () => {
it("should handle malformed cookie strings", () => {
mockLocation.hostname = "test.appsmith.com";

cookieStore = "malformed cookie string without proper format";

expect(() => getRecentDomains()).not.toThrow();
expect(() => trackCurrentDomain()).not.toThrow();
});

it("should handle empty domain strings", () => {
expect(isValidAppsmithDomain("")).toBe(false);
});

it("should handle special characters in domain names", () => {
expect(isValidAppsmithDomain("test-org.appsmith.com")).toBe(true);
expect(isValidAppsmithDomain("test_org.appsmith.com")).toBe(true);
expect(isValidAppsmithDomain("test.org.appsmith.com")).toBe(true);
});
});

describe("cookie management", () => {
it("should set cookie with correct expiry date", () => {
mockLocation.hostname = "example.appsmith.com";

trackCurrentDomain();

const setCookieCall = mockCookieSetter.mock.calls[0][0];

expect(setCookieCall).toContain("expires=");
expect(setCookieCall).toContain("domain=.appsmith.com");
expect(setCookieCall).toContain("path=/");
expect(setCookieCall).toContain("SameSite=Lax");
});

it("should encode cookie values properly", () => {
mockLocation.hostname = "example.appsmith.com";

trackCurrentDomain();

const setCookieCall = mockCookieSetter.mock.calls[0][0];
const cookieValue = setCookieCall.split("=")[1].split(";")[0];

expect(() => {
const decoded = decodeURIComponent(cookieValue);

JSON.parse(decoded);
}).not.toThrow();
});
});
});
